#778007 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#778007 is composed of 46.7% red, 50.2% green and 2.7%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 7% cyan, 0% magenta, 94.5% yellow and 49.8% black. It has a hue angle of 64.5 degrees, a saturation of 89.6% and a lightness of 26.5%. #778007 color hex could be obtained by blending #eeff0e with #000100. Closest websafe color is: #669900.

#778007 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#778007 has RGB values of R:119, G:128, B:7 and CMYK values of C:0.07, M:0, Y:0.95, K:0.5. Its decimal value is 7831559.
